/arkcompiler/ets_runtime/ecmascript/jspandafile/accessor/ |
H A D | module_data_accessor.cpp | 65 JSMutableHandle<JSTaggedValue> importName(thread, globalConstants->GetUndefined()); in EnumerateImportEntry() 70 ReadRegularImportEntry(&sp, factory, requestModuleArray, importName, localName, moduleRequest); in EnumerateImportEntry() 71 JSHandle<ImportEntry> importEntry = factory->NewImportEntry(moduleRequest, importName, localName, in EnumerateImportEntry() 89 importName.Update(globalConstants->GetHandledStarString()); in EnumerateImportEntry() 93 JSHandle<ImportEntry> importEntry = factory->NewImportEntry(moduleRequest, importName, localName, in EnumerateImportEntry() 103 JSMutableHandle<JSTaggedValue> &importName, in ReadRegularImportEntry() 116 importName.Update(JSTaggedValue(factory->GetRawStringFromStringTable(sd))); in ReadRegularImportEntry() 200 JSHandle<JSTaggedValue> importName(thread, factory->GetRawStringFromStringTable(sd)); in EnumerateIndirectExportEntry() 206 moduleRequest, importName, sharedType); in EnumerateIndirectExportEntry() 101 ReadRegularImportEntry(Span<const uint8_t> *sp, ObjectFactory *factory, const JSHandle<TaggedArray> &requestModuleArray, JSMutableHandle<JSTaggedValue> &importName, JSMutableHandle<JSTaggedValue> &localName, JSMutableHandle<JSTaggedValue> &moduleRequest) ReadRegularImportEntry() argument
|
H A D | module_data_accessor.h | 64 JSMutableHandle<JSTaggedValue> &importName,
|
/arkcompiler/ets_frontend/es2panda/parser/module/ |
H A D | sourceTextModuleRecord.h | 56 ImportEntry(const util::StringView localName, const util::StringView importName, int moduleRequestIdx, in ImportEntry() 58 : moduleRequestIdx_(moduleRequestIdx), localName_(localName), importName_(importName), in ImportEntry() 79 ExportEntry(const util::StringView exportName, const util::StringView importName, int moduleRequest, in ExportEntry() 81 : moduleRequestIdx_(moduleRequest), exportName_(exportName), importName_(importName), in ExportEntry()
|
/arkcompiler/ets_frontend/es2panda/compiler/core/emitter/ |
H A D | moduleRecordEmitter.cpp | 53 panda::pandasm::LiteralArray::Literal importName = { in GenRegularImportEntries() local 55 buffer_.emplace_back(importName); in GenRegularImportEntries() 121 panda::pandasm::LiteralArray::Literal importName = { in GenIndirectExportEntries() local 123 buffer_.emplace_back(importName); in GenIndirectExportEntries()
|
/arkcompiler/ets_runtime/ecmascript/tests/ |
H A D | shared_object_factory_test.cpp | 48 JSHandle<EcmaString> importName = factory->NewFromASCII("importName"); in HWTEST_F_L0() local 52 JSHandle<JSTaggedValue>::Cast(importName), in HWTEST_F_L0() 54 ASSERT_EQ(entry->GetImportName().GetRawData(), JSHandle<JSTaggedValue>::Cast(importName)->GetRawData()); in HWTEST_F_L0() 78 JSHandle<JSTaggedValue>::Cast(factory->NewFromASCII("importName"))); in HWTEST_F_L0() 82 JSHandle<JSTaggedValue>::Cast(factory->NewFromASCII("importName"))->GetRawData()); in HWTEST_F_L0()
|
/arkcompiler/ets_frontend/ets2panda/varbinder/ |
H A D | declaration.h | 333 explicit ImportDecl(util::StringView importName, util::StringView localName) in ImportDecl() argument 334 : Decl(localName), importName_(importName) in ImportDecl() 338 explicit ImportDecl(util::StringView importName, util::StringView localName, ir::AstNode *node) in ImportDecl() argument 339 : Decl(localName), importName_(importName) in ImportDecl()
|
H A D | ETSBinder.h | 289 void HandleStarImport(ir::TSQualifiedName *importName, util::StringView fullPath);
|
/arkcompiler/ets_runtime/ecmascript/module/ |
H A D | module_logger.cpp | 72 // get importName in InsertModuleLoadInfo() 79 JSHandle<JSTaggedValue> importName(thread, importEntry->GetImportName()); in InsertModuleLoadInfo() 80 exportNameStr = ModulePathHelper::Utf8ConvertToString(importName.GetTaggedValue()); in InsertModuleLoadInfo()
|
H A D | js_module_source_text.cpp | 697 JSMutableHandle<JSTaggedValue> importName(thread, globalConstants->GetUndefined()); in ModuleDeclarationEnvironmentSetup() 702 importName.Update(in->GetImportName()); in ModuleDeclarationEnvironmentSetup() 720 if (JSTaggedValue::SameValue(importName, starString)) { in ModuleDeclarationEnvironmentSetup() 733 SourceTextModule::ResolveExport(thread, importedModule, importName, resolveVector); in ModuleDeclarationEnvironmentSetup() 739 ConvertToString(importName.GetTaggedValue()); in ModuleDeclarationEnvironmentSetup() 797 JSMutableHandle<JSTaggedValue> importName(thread, globalConstants->GetUndefined()); in ModuleDeclarationArrayEnvironmentSetup() 800 importName.Update(in->GetImportName()); in ModuleDeclarationArrayEnvironmentSetup() 818 if (JSTaggedValue::SameValue(importName, starString)) { in ModuleDeclarationArrayEnvironmentSetup() 830 SourceTextModule::ResolveExport(thread, importedModule, importName, resolveVector); in ModuleDeclarationArrayEnvironmentSetup() 836 ConvertToString(importName in ModuleDeclarationArrayEnvironmentSetup() [all...] |
/arkcompiler/ets_runtime/ecmascript/debugger/ |
H A D | debugger_api.cpp | 471 JSTaggedValue importName = ee->GetImportName(); in GetImportModule() local 473 if (localName.IsString() && !JSTaggedValue::SameValue(importName, starString.GetTaggedValue())) { in GetImportModule() 484 name = EcmaStringAccessor(importName).ToStdString(); in GetImportModule() 757 std::string importName = EcmaStringAccessor(ee->GetImportName()).ToStdString(); in GetIndirectExportVariables() local 758 Local<JSValueRef> value = GetModuleValue(ecmaVm, importModule, importName); in GetIndirectExportVariables()
|
/arkcompiler/ets_runtime/ecmascript/ |
H A D | object_factory.h | 675 const JSHandle<JSTaggedValue> &importName, 685 const JSHandle<JSTaggedValue> &importName, 820 const JSHandle<JSTaggedValue> &importName, 828 const JSHandle<JSTaggedValue> &importName);
|
H A D | shared_object_factory.cpp | 768 const JSHandle<JSTaggedValue> &importName, in NewSImportEntry() 776 obj->SetImportName(thread_, importName); in NewSImportEntry() 796 const JSHandle<JSTaggedValue> &importName) in NewSIndirectExportEntry() 804 obj->SetImportName(thread_, importName); in NewSIndirectExportEntry() 767 NewSImportEntry(const JSHandle<JSTaggedValue> &moduleRequest, const JSHandle<JSTaggedValue> &importName, const JSHandle<JSTaggedValue> &localName) NewSImportEntry() argument 794 NewSIndirectExportEntry(const JSHandle<JSTaggedValue> &exportName, const JSHandle<JSTaggedValue> &moduleRequest, const JSHandle<JSTaggedValue> &importName) NewSIndirectExportEntry() argument
|
H A D | object_factory.cpp | 4612 const JSHandle<JSTaggedValue> &importName, in NewImportEntry() 4617 return NewSImportEntry(moduleRequest, importName, localName); in NewImportEntry() 4624 obj->SetImportName(thread_, importName); in NewImportEntry() 4660 const JSHandle<JSTaggedValue> &importName, in NewIndirectExportEntry() 4664 return NewSIndirectExportEntry(exportName, moduleRequest, importName); in NewIndirectExportEntry() 4672 obj->SetImportName(thread_, importName); in NewIndirectExportEntry() 4611 NewImportEntry(const JSHandle<JSTaggedValue> &moduleRequest, const JSHandle<JSTaggedValue> &importName, const JSHandle<JSTaggedValue> &localName, SharedTypes sharedTypes) NewImportEntry() argument 4658 NewIndirectExportEntry(const JSHandle<JSTaggedValue> &exportName, const JSHandle<JSTaggedValue> &moduleRequest, const JSHandle<JSTaggedValue> &importName, SharedTypes sharedTypes) NewIndirectExportEntry() argument
|
/arkcompiler/ets_frontend/es2panda/binder/ |
H A D | binder.cpp | 731 auto importName = annoName.substr(0, annoName.find_first_of(".")); in ResolveReference() local 732 ScopeFindResult res = scope_->Find(util::StringView(importName), bindingOptions_); in ResolveReference()
|
/arkcompiler/ets_frontend/es2panda/parser/ |
H A D | statementParser.cpp | 2265 auto importName = specifier->AsImportSpecifier()->Imported()->Name(); in AddImportEntryItemForImportSpecifier() local 2269 localName, importName, moduleRequestIdx, localId, importId); in AddImportEntryItemForImportSpecifier() 2282 auto importName = parser::SourceTextModuleRecord::DEFAULT_EXTERNAL_NAME; in AddImportEntryItemForImportDefaultOrNamespaceSpecifier() local 2285 localName, importName, moduleRequestIdx, localId, nullptr); in AddImportEntryItemForImportDefaultOrNamespaceSpecifier() 2313 auto importName = exportSpecifier->Local()->Name(); in AddExportNamedEntryItem() local 2318 exportName, importName, moduleRequestIdx, exportId, importId); in AddExportNamedEntryItem()
|
/arkcompiler/ets_runtime/ecmascript/module/tests/ |
H A D | ecma_module_test.cpp | 1515 JSHandle<JSTaggedValue> importName = JSHandle<JSTaggedValue>::Cast(objectFactory->NewFromUtf8("ccc")); in HWTEST_F_L0() local 1517 JSHandle<ImportEntry> importEntry = objectFactory->NewImportEntry(moduleRequest, importName, in HWTEST_F_L0() 2674 JSHandle<JSTaggedValue> importName = val; in HWTEST_F_L0() local 2677 objectFactory->NewImportEntry(moduleRequest, importName, localName, SharedTypes::UNSENDABLE_MODULE); in HWTEST_F_L0()
|